var str = base64.encode64("这是测试"); alert(base64.decode64(str)); 1.Base64编码与解码:(未验证) 复制代码 代码如下: var base64EncodeChars =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789+/"; var base64DecodeChars = new Array(-1, -1, -1, -1, -1, -1, -1, -1,...
utf8mb4--》utf-8,最多4个字节表示一个字符---》存标签,存生僻字 base64与md5 copy # base64只是编码格式,编码与解码,不涉及加密 base64 : 用64个字符来表示任意二进制数据,只能指定二进制类型进行base64编码,变长,可反解。 # md5 : 加密格式,固定长度,不可反解。
分享给大家供大家参考,具体如下:要进行编码的字符串:“select用户名from用户”用法JAVA进行编码,Java程序:Stringsql="select用户名from用户";StringencodeStr=newString(Base64.encode(sql.getBytes("UTF-8")));//编码System.out.println(encodeStr);得到:c2VsZWN0IOeUqOaIt+WQjSBmcm9tIOeUqOaItw==在Java中...
String encodeStr = new String(Base64.encode(sql.getBytes("UTF-8"))); // 编码 System.out.println(encodeStr); 得到: c2VsZWN0IOeUqOaIt+WQjSBmcm9tIOeUqOaItw== 在Java中解码: sql = new String(Base64.decode(sql.getBytes()), "UTF-8"); Java代码中为什么要使用getBytes("UTF-8")呢?因为...
1、JS实现对中文字符串进行utf-8的Base64编码的方法(使其与Java编码相同)_ 本文实例讲解并描述了JS实现对中文字符串进行utf-8的Base64编码的方法。分享给大家供大家参考,具体如下: 要进行编码的字符串:“select 用户名 from 用户” 用法JAVA进行编码,Java程序: String sql = select 用户名 from 用户; String ...
from 用户“; String encodeStr = new String(.encode(sql.getBytes(“UTF-8“))); // 编码 System.out.println(encodeStr); 得到: c2VsZWN0IOeUqOaIt+WQjSBmcm9tIOeUqOaItw== 在Java中解码: sql = new String(.decode(sql.getBytes()), “UTF-8“); Java代码中为什么要用法getBytes(“UTF-8“)...
此字符集无法显示多字节utf8字符。要获取utf8多字节字符,请直接转到base64,然后再返回 ...
多心**心酸 上传53KB 文件格式 pdf 中文字符串 utf-8 Base64编码 主要介绍了JS实现对中文字符串进行utf-8的Base64编码的方法,对比java的base64编码程序,分析了javascript实现base64编码的相关技巧,需要的朋友可以参考下点赞(0) 踩踩(0) 反馈 所需:1 积分 电信网络下载 ...
本文给大家介绍的是javascript中的Base64、UTF8编码与解码的函数源码分享以及使用范例,十分实用,推荐给小伙伴们,希望大家能够喜欢。 Base64编码说明 Base64编码要求把3个8位字节(3*8=24)转化为4个6位的字节(4*6=24),之后在6位的前面补两个0,形成8位一个字节的形式。 如果剩下的字符不足3个字节,则用0填充...
本文给大家介绍的是javascript中的Base64、UTF8编码与解码的函数源码分享以及使用范例,十分实用,推荐给小伙伴们,希望大家能够喜欢。 Base64编码说明 Base64编码要求把3个8位字节(3*8=24)转化为4个6位的字节(4*6=24),之后在6位的前面补两个0,形成8位一个字节的形式。 如果剩下的字符不足3个字节,则用0填充...